Urban ecology is the subfield of ecology which studies exactly what this whole essay is about, the interaction of plants, animals, humans with each other and their enviroment in urban or urbanizing settings. Ecology alone is an extensive study of the relationships of everything within the world and when you add humans into the equation it gets even more complicated as we see the effects we have on the earth; positive and negative.
